Sodexo is seeking a Chef for Priory Hospital Enfield, requiring passion for cooking and strong culinary skills. You'll prepare and cook high-quality meals, contribute to menu planning, and support junior staff.

The position includes a competitive rate of £14.06 per hour, alongside a host of benefits like mental health resources, a retirement plan, and flexible working opportunities.

If you thrive in a dynamic kitchen environment and have at least 2 years of cooking experience, apply now to be part of a purpose-driven team.

How to prepare for a job interview at Sodexo

Show Your Passion for Cooking

Make sure to express your love for cooking during the interview. Share specific examples of dishes you enjoy preparing and how you keep up with culinary trends. This will demonstrate your enthusiasm and commitment to high-quality meal preparation.

Highlight Your Experience

With at least 2 years of cooking experience required, be ready to discuss your previous roles in detail. Talk about the types of cuisines you've worked with, any menu planning you've done, and how you've contributed to a team environment. This will help them see how you fit into their kitchen.

Prepare for Scenario Questions

Expect questions that assess your problem-solving skills in a busy kitchen. Think of scenarios where you had to adapt quickly or support junior staff. Practising these responses will show that you're ready for the dynamic environment at Priory Hospital.

Ask About Team Dynamics

Show your interest in the team by asking questions about how they collaborate in the kitchen. Inquire about their approach to mentoring junior staff and how they maintain a patient-focused environment. This will reflect your understanding of the role's importance in a healthcare setting.
